Abstract

A counterflow leak-detector unit (1) with an inlet (2) connected to a test specimen, or a chamber housing a test specimen. A high-vacuum pump (4) produces pressure in a test-gas detector. The inlet (2) to the leak-detector unit is connected to an intermediate line (16) in the high-vacuum pump (4). To increase detection sensitivity without any danger of the pressure in the detector rising to inadmissible levels, a constriction (17) is located between two high-vacuum pump states (5, 6) of the high vacuum pump (4). Pump stages (5, 6) are separated by the intermediate line (16). The inlet (2) to the leak-detector unit (1) is connected to the outlet side of the high-vacuum pump state (5) at a point upstream of the constriction (17).

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A countertflow leak-detector that includes a gas detector for detecting the presence of a specimen;   a multistage high vacuum pump having an upper pump stage connected to the gas detector for bringing the pressure in said gas detector to a predetermined level and a second lower pump stage connected to the upper pump stage by an intermediate flow line, said pump stages each having an inlet side and an outlet side;   a constriction in said intermediate flow line;   a means for containing a specimen; and   a connecting means for coupling said intermediate flow line and said means for containing a specimen, for introducing a specimen into said intermediate flow line.   
     
     
       2. The counterflow leak-detector according to claim 1, wherein said connecting means enters said intermediate flow line between said constriction and said upper pump stage. 
     
     
       3. The counterflow leak-detector according to claim 1, wherein said connecting means enters said intermediate flow line between said constriction and said lower pump stage. 
     
     
       4. The counterflow leak-detector according to claim 1, further comprising a common supply line (11) having a valve (12), operatively connected therein, said common supply line mounted between said outlet side of said lower pump stage and said means for containing a specimen. 
     
     
       5. The counterflow leak-detector according to claim 4, further comprising a lower line (7) having lower valve (8) and forevacuum pump (9), said forevacuum pump located on said outlet side of said lower pump stage, said common supply line connecting into said lower line between said lower valve and said forevacuum pump. 
     
     
       6. The counterflow leak-detector according to claim 1, wherein said constriction further comprises a means fur maintaining the conductance constant. 
     
     
       7. The counterflow leak-detector according to claim 6, wherein said means for maintaining the conductance includes a fixed ring disc (22), and said high-vacuum pump is a dual-stage drag pump. 
     
     
       8. The counterflow leak-detector according to claim 1, wherein said constriction further includes a means for controlling the conductance. 
     
     
       9. The counterflow leak-detector according to claim 8, wherein said means for controlling the conductance includes a ring disc (22) having adjustable components (26), and said high-vacuum pump is a dual-stage drag pump. 
     
     
       10. The counterflow leak-detector according to claim 9, wherein said components are made of materials having a shape memory effect capable of adjusting said constriction. 
     
     
       11. The counterflow leak-detector according to claim 1, wherein said upper pump stage and said lower pump stage are formed by two separate drag pumps. 
     
     
       12. The counterflow leak-detector according to claim 1, wherein said upper pump stage and said lower pump stage each having a separate rotor mounted on a common shaft (21). 
     
     
       13. The counterflow leak-detector according to claim 1, wherein said upper pump stage is a turbomolecular pump and said lower pump stage is a drag pump. 
     
     
       14. The counterflow leak-detector according to claim 1, wherein said upper pump stage is a turbomolecular pump with a relatively low compression for light gases and dimensioned such that it will generate on the pressure side a pressure of approximately 0.1 mbar or less, and wherein said lower pump stage is a screw-type pump having a relatively high pumping speed and dimensioned to produce on its outlet side a pressure of over 0.1 mbar, preferably 1 mbar. 
     
     
       15. The counterflow leak-detector according to claim 1, wherein said upper pump stage further contains two sections (5a, 5b). 
     
     
       16. The counterflow-leak detector according to claim 15, wherein said intermediate flow line is located between said two sections.
